查询到最新的1条

Powerjob无锁化设计

该文将从多个方面对Powerjob的无锁化设计进行详细阐述。 一、简介 Powerjob是一种轻量级分布式任务调度框架,适用于各种复杂的分布式任务场景。Powerjob无锁化设计是其主要特点之一。 二、什么是无锁化设计 无锁化设计是指通过设计让程序在并发环境下不使用锁来保证线程安全。它相比传统的锁机制,可以更好地发挥多核处理器的优势,增强程序的性能和吞吐量。Powerjob的无锁化设计主要体现在以下两个方面: 1. 基于CAS机制实现任务分配 while 继续阅读